Background

The 2026 ICC Men's T20 World Cup is the tenth edition, co-hosted by India and Sri Lanka from February 7 to March 8, 2026. India are the defending champions, while New Zealand seek their maiden T20 World Cup crown. India can become the first team to successfully defend the T20 World Cup title and the first three-time winners in the tournament's history. India claimed a 4-1 victory when the two sides met in a five-match T20I series in January.

Considerations

In T20 World Cups, New Zealand have dominated India in their three previous encounters, though India lead 18-11 in overall T20I head-to-head record. This is the first time India and New Zealand will meet in a T20 World Cup final.
